“So far, about 90 athletes in skateboarding, BMX stunt bike riding and freestyle motocross have joined what is known as the Pro Riders Organization, essentially an association, which was begun two years ago. The group’s agenda includes a wider distribution of prize money; revenue sharing with the television networks, who own the biggest events; group licensing agreements; greater input into how courses are designed because of concerns about safety and performance; and health insurance - which an estimated half of the athletes do not have.”
